[Bug 226015] Re: Unable to enable nvidia restricted drivers in Hardy
The nvidia drivers were installed via restricted drivers manager on 7.10. Seems that the situation is more alike other cases I've seen on some forums. After reinstalling the restricted modules, doing sudo apt-get install linux-restricted-modules-2.6.24-17-generic --reinstall I could load the module sudo nvidia-xconfig sudo modprobe nvidia sudo /etc/init.d/gdm start and X appeared. The problem, now, is that this configuration seems nonpersistent.
